From 9f829b3522533d73dc9f10bdc28d223e5cc12179 Mon Sep 17 00:00:00 2001 From: helge Date: Wed, 9 Feb 2005 11:17:13 +0000 Subject: [PATCH] added a method to retrieve the currently selected IMAP4 folder git-svn-id: http://svn.opengroupware.org/SOPE/trunk@545 e4a50df8-12e2-0310-a44c-efbce7f8a7e3 --- sope-mime/ChangeLog | 2 ++ sope-mime/NGImap4/ChangeLog | 3 +++ sope-mime/NGImap4/NGImap4Client.h | 2 ++ sope-mime/NGImap4/NGImap4Client.m | 4 ++++ sope-mime/Version | 2 +- 5 files changed, 12 insertions(+), 1 deletion(-) diff --git a/sope-mime/ChangeLog b/sope-mime/ChangeLog index e10fe015..55707e4a 100644 --- a/sope-mime/ChangeLog +++ b/sope-mime/ChangeLog @@ -1,5 +1,7 @@ 2005-02-08 Helge Hess + * NGImap4: added method to retrieve selected folder (v4.5.211) + * NGImap4: change in API: NGImap4Envelope now uses lists for 'from' and 'reply-to' headers (v4.5.210) diff --git a/sope-mime/NGImap4/ChangeLog b/sope-mime/NGImap4/ChangeLog index 16d4b691..5d41d188 100644 --- a/sope-mime/NGImap4/ChangeLog +++ b/sope-mime/NGImap4/ChangeLog @@ -1,5 +1,8 @@ 2005-02-08 Helge Hess + * NGImap4Client.m: added -selectedFolderName method to retrieve the + folder which was selected last + * NGImap4ResponseParser.m: properly parse from/reply-to as lists * NGImap4Envelope.m: properly use NSArray for 'from' and 'reply-to', diff --git a/sope-mime/NGImap4/NGImap4Client.h b/sope-mime/NGImap4/NGImap4Client.h index dcd65245..cf337637 100644 --- a/sope-mime/NGImap4/NGImap4Client.h +++ b/sope-mime/NGImap4/NGImap4Client.h @@ -96,6 +96,8 @@ typedef enum { - (NSString *)delimiter; - (EOGlobalID *)serverGlobalID; +- (NSString *)selectedFolderName; + /* notifications */ - (void)registerForResponseNotification:(id)_obj; diff --git a/sope-mime/NGImap4/NGImap4Client.m b/sope-mime/NGImap4/NGImap4Client.m index cf3059b5..fbc53a36 100644 --- a/sope-mime/NGImap4/NGImap4Client.m +++ b/sope-mime/NGImap4/NGImap4Client.m @@ -258,6 +258,10 @@ static BOOL ImapDebugEnabled = NO; return self->serverGID; } +- (NSString *)selectedFolderName { + return self->selectedFolder; +} + /* connection */ - (id)_openSocket { diff --git a/sope-mime/Version b/sope-mime/Version index 4d323dc0..91a8de37 100644 --- a/sope-mime/Version +++ b/sope-mime/Version @@ -2,6 +2,6 @@ MAJOR_VERSION:=4 MINOR_VERSION:=5 -SUBMINOR_VERSION:=210 +SUBMINOR_VERSION:=211 # v4.2.149 requires libNGStreams v4.2.34 -- 2.39.5